Rosé releases 'New Trick' with video shot on iPhone 18 Pro

BLACKPINK singer Rosé has released a new single, “New Trick”, with an official music video directed by Dave Meyers. The release was reported by Billboard on 18 September 2026.
The video was filmed entirely on Apple’s iPhone 18 Pro. Apple has newly unveiled that model as its latest iPhone. The clip was teased through Apple’s “Shot on iPhone” campaign.
That campaign has a pop history. It previously featured The Weeknd’s “Dancing in the Flames”, Olivia Rodrigo’s “Get Him Back!” and Lady Gaga’s “Stupid Love”, according to Billboard.
Meyers is an American director with a long list of music video credits. He also directed Blackpink’s “Jump”, as reported by the Korea Herald. Rosé’s channel listed “new trick (OFFICIAL MUSIC VIDEO)” for release on 17 September at 7pm EST.
Rosé described the song in Vogue as possibly the cutest thing she and songwriter Amy Allen have ever made together. Allen is credited as a co-writer on the track.
The release follows a strong chart run for Rosé as a solo artist. Her 2024 single “APT.”, a collaboration with Bruno Mars, peaked at No. 3 on the Billboard Hot 100, the US singles chart. It then logged 45 weeks on that chart.
Her debut solo album “Rosie” debuted at No. 3 on Billboard in December 2024. Rosé was born in New Zealand and raised in Melbourne.
